Can You Bring Dogs to Siesta Key Beach?

Siesta Beach is one of the most famous beaches in Florida. Its soft sand and wide shoreline attract visitors from across the country. However, dogs are not allowed on Siesta Beach or most public beaches on the island. Sarasota County maintains these rules to protect wildlife, keep the beach clean, and ensure a comfortable environment for all visitors.

Brohard Paw Park: The Ultimate Venice Dog Beach

The most popular dog beach in the area is Brohard Paw Park in Venice. It’s about a 30-minute drive south of Siesta Key and one of the only fully designated dog beaches along Florida’s Gulf Coast. Often referred to simply as the Venice dog beach, this location is well known among locals and visitors alike.

What makes Brohard Paw Park special:

  • A fenced dog park connected directly to the beach
  • A leash-free shoreline where dogs can swim and run
  • Dog showers and paw wash stations
  • Separate fenced areas for large and small dogs
  • Nearby picnic areas and shaded seating

The beach area itself allows dogs to roam off-leash, making it a favorite for active pets that love the water. Parking is available near the park, and the surrounding Venice area has several restaurants and walking paths to explore after beach time. Exploring Other Sarasota Pet-Friendly Beaches and Parks

While Brohard Paw Park is the only official dog beach in Sarasota County, several parks nearby provide space for dogs to exercise and enjoy coastal views.

Here are a few popular options:

1. Bird Key Park

Located between Sarasota and St. Armands Key, Bird Key Park offers open grassy areas and water views.

Dogs must stay on a leash, but it’s a peaceful location for walking and enjoying the bay.

2. South Lido County Park

South Lido Park has beautiful nature trails and shaded picnic areas. While dogs are not allowed on the beach itself, they are welcome on the park’s walking trails when leashed.

3. Arlington Park Dog Park

This fenced dog park in Sarasota provides separate areas for large and small dogs, along with shaded seating for owners.

These locations may not offer off-leash beach access, but they still give pets space to stretch their legs during your vacation.
